Health officials are investigating a probable case of swine flu in Roscommon.

A man presented himself at hospital on Saturday and initial tests indicate he has the virus, but a sample has been sent to the UK for confirmation.

The patient, who is believed to be from the US, has been placed in isolation and a small number of people who were in contact with him are being treated with Tamiflu.

Eleven other cases of swine flu have already been confirmed in Ireland.
